Bring a Tracking Device

It is essential that you let someone know where you will be going. This is just a precaution. If something happens, someone can pinpoint where you were last at. It is also recommended that you bring a tracker with you.

Wear the Right Clothes

It is essential to wear comfortable clothing for hiking. Do not wear clothes that are made of cotton. They will become wetter and continue to rub so much and feel the moisture when you put them on. Choose synthetics. Use something that will add an extra layer on top of that, Breeze.

Keep It Light

It is important to pack light, so you won’t be having a hard time when hiking. Pack the lightest things that you will be bringing along with you during the hike. This is an important factor to consider because this will help in the long run of hiking.…
